How long do cut protea flowers last? While some species of protea can last up to two and a half weeks, most last on average only 8 days. One of the lovely things about a protea is that once cut and put in a vase, it should last for about 7 to 14 days when properly cared for. Cut protea flowers last longer if you remove leaves that will be below water and cut off the last 2 inches of stem.
